Last night, Jennifer Aniston (in a strapless nude Valentino) hit the fashionable U.K. department store Harrod’s to launch her first-ever signature scent. “I wanted this fragrance to be a personal library of scent memories,” the star said in a press release. “For example, my love of night blooming jasmine has lasted a lifetime. Growing up in California, I distinctly remember the scent of the jasmine on summer evenings.” Although Aniston has discussed her inspiration for the scent (and why it was such a labor of love), she’s stayed tight-lipped on the subject of the perfume’s actual name. So there’s been much speculation as to why she chose to stick with her own sobriquet after first considering calling it Lolavie; we’re thinking that despite the  “personal…and special significance” of the old name, it might have been too easily confused with Marc Jacobs’s Lola.
